什么是区块链上链?一文解析区块链上链的含义
随着区块链技术的迅猛发展,越来越多的人开始接触并关注这一新兴技术。在区块链技术的应用中,“上链”这一概念常常被提及。什么是“区块链上链”?为什么它如此重要?简而言之,区块链上链指的是将特定数据或信息通过技术手段录入到区块链系统中,使得这些信息可以被去中心化存储并不可篡改。上链过程一旦完成,这些数据将受到区块链的保护,确保其透明性、可追溯性和安全性。在接下来的文章中,我们将深入解析区块链上链的含义、过程及其在不同领域的应用,帮助读者更好地理解这一概念及其实际意义。
一、区块链上链的定义
区块链上链(Blockchain On-chain)是指将现实世界中的某些信息、数据、交易等内容通过特定的技术手段和协议记录到区块链网络中。这些数据一旦上链,就会被写入到区块链的一个个区块里,并通过加密技术进行保护,形成一个不可篡改的链条。任何经过上链的内容都将具有去中心化、公开透明和不可更改的特点。
区块链作为一种分布式账本技术,其核心特点之一就是去中心化和数据不可篡改。当数据上链后,所有参与者都可以查看这些信息,但无法对其进行修改或删除。这种特性使得区块链在多个行业领域中具有了重要的应用价值,尤其是在金融、供应链管理、版权保护、数字身份等领域。
二、区块链上链的过程
区块链上链并非是一个简单的操作,它涉及到多个技术步骤。一般来说,区块链上链的过程可以分为以下几个阶段:
1. 数据采集
上链的第一步是数据采集。这意味着要收集和整理需要上链的数据,包括文本、图片、音视频文件等各种类型的数字信息。对于区块链而言,数据本身并不重要,重要的是如何将这些数据通过一定的格式和协议转化为区块链可以存储的信息。
2. 数据加密
为了保证数据的安全性和隐私性,所有需要上链的数据都会经过加密处理。加密技术不仅保证了数据内容的保密性,同时也防止了数据在传输过程中被篡改。常见的加密方式包括哈希加密、对称加密和非对称加密等。数据加密后,将保证上链的数据即便在不可信的网络环境中传输,也能够确保其不被泄露或修改。
3. 数据上传
数据加密完成后,接下来就是将数据上传到区块链网络中。这一阶段需要通过智能合约、区块链节点或其他技术接口,将加密后的数据提交到区块链上。上传过程需要通过区块链的共识机制进行验证,确保数据是合法的、真实的且符合网络规定。
4. 数据确认与打包
上传到区块链的交易信息将被网络中的矿工或节点进行验证和确认。当数据通过验证后,它将被打包成区块,并加盖时间戳。一旦区块被打包并加入到区块链中,数据就被认为是“上链”完成。区块链的去中心化特性确保了所有参与者可以共同监督和确认这些数据。
5. 数据查询与访问
数据上链后,任何人都可以通过区块链浏览器等工具进行查询和访问。由于区块链的公开透明性,所有上链的数据都可以公开查看,但只有拥有权限的用户才能对数据进行操作或解密。这个特点使得区块链在很多需要确保信息公开和可追溯的场景中都有着广泛应用。
三、区块链上链的优势
区块链上链的优势主要体现在以下几个方面:
1. 数据不可篡改
区块链的最大特点之一就是其不可篡改性。一旦数据上链,它就无法被更改、删除或伪造。这对于许多需要保证数据真实可靠的行业非常重要。例如,在金融行业,银行和其他机构可以利用区块链技术确保交易记录的不可篡改,防止出现欺诈行为。
2. 透明性和可追溯性
区块链提供了完整的交易历史记录,任何上链的数据都可以追溯。透明性和可追溯性是区块链的关键特性之一,它为用户提供了完全的信任保障。在供应链管理、版权保护等领域,数据上链后,可以实现全过程的追溯,确保每一环节的透明性。
3. 去中心化
区块链技术通过去中心化的方式避免了单一机构或个人对数据的控制。当数据上链后,它将分布在区块链网络中的多个节点上,没有任何一个单一方能够掌控或篡改这些数据。这种去中心化的特性使得区块链在保障信息安全的增强了系统的抗攻击能力。
4. 数据安全性
数据上链后通过加密技术进行保护,能够有效防止数据被黑客攻击或非法篡改。区块链通过多重加密手段,保证了数据的完整性和安全性。在涉及到敏感信息时,区块链技术能够有效避免传统数据库的安全漏洞。
5. 自动化和智能合约
区块链还可以通过智能合约技术实现自动化操作。智能合约是一种自执行的合同,一旦条件满足,合同内容就会自动执行。通过将合约内容上链,区块链可以确保合约内容不被篡改,并且可以自动进行相关操作。这一特性在金融、法律、供应链等领域有着广泛的应用。
四、区块链上链的应用场景
区块链上链技术的优势使其在多个行业和领域得到了应用,以下是一些典型的应用场景:
1. 数字货币
区块链最著名的应用无疑是比特币和其他数字货币。在这些数字货币的交易中,每一笔交易都需要通过区块链上链,确保交易的透明性和安全性。通过区块链技术,用户能够实时查看所有交易记录,并确保这些记录不会被篡改。
2. 供应链管理
在传统供应链管理中,信息流通不畅且容易受到中介机构的干扰。通过区块链技术,可以将供应链中的每一环节信息进行上链,从生产、运输到销售的全过程都可以实现追溯和透明化。这不仅提高了供应链的效率,还能有效防止假冒伪劣商品的流通。
3. 知识产权保护
区块链技术可以有效保护创作者的知识产权。通过将作品的版权信息、创作时间等数据上链,可以确保作品的原创性并防止版权纠纷。例如,艺术品、音乐作品、软件代码等内容可以通过上链的方式进行保护,确保创作者的权益。
4. 电子票据与身份认证
区块链上链技术也被应用于电子票据和身份认证领域。通过将票据和身份信息上链,可以避免伪造和篡改问题。例如,某些企业通过将员工的身份认证信息上链,确保只有授权的人员可以访问敏感资源。
五、区块链上链的挑战与未来展望
尽管区块链技术在许多领域展现了强大的优势,但在实际应用过程中也面临一些挑战。区块链上链的数据存储成本较高,尤其是在存储大量数据时,可能导致网络的性能瓶颈。区块链的技术复杂性也要求用户具备较高的技术门槛,尤其是在智能合约的设计和部署过程中。区块链的普及需要全行业的标准化和协调,以确保不同平台和系统之间的兼容性。
随着区块链技术的不断发展和创新,这些问题有望得到解决。未来,区块链技术将更加高效、智能化,更多的行业将实现数据上链,从而推动区块链在全球范围内的广泛应用。
问答环节
1. 上链数据是否可以被修改或删除?
一旦数据上链,它将变得不可篡改或删除。这是区块链技术的一个重要特点——数据不可篡改性。数据一旦进入区块链网络,所有节点都会保存这份记录,因此无法随意修改。
2. 所有数据都适合上链吗?
并不是所有数据都适合上链。区块链适合存储一些需要去中心化、公开透明和不可篡改的数据,如金融交易记录、供应链数据、版权信息等。而对于一些频繁变动或隐私性较强的数据,则可能不适合上链。
3. 区块链上链的费用高吗?
区块链上链的费用与所使用的区块链网络和上链数据的大小有关。比如以太坊等公共区块链网络的交易费用可能相对较高,但随着技术的进步和区块链应用的广泛推广,费用问题有望逐渐得到缓解。
4. 区块链上链能带来哪些实际的业务效益?
区块链上链可以提高数据的透明度、减少中介成本、提升交易效率、确保数据的安全性和不可篡改性,从而为各行业带来业务效益。在供应链管理、金融交易、知识产权保护等领域,区块链上链能够显著降低风险,提升信任度。